Indienne Collection by Zoffany Presents Printed Wallpapers and Fabrics

— February 18, 2026 — Art & Design
The Indienne Collection by Zoffany is a range of printed wallpapers and fabrics inspired by historical Indian cotton printing techniques. Launched at the Dezeen Showroom, the collection features hand-drawn motifs and repeating patterns executed in a palette that reflects traditional block-printed textiles. Designs include floral and geometric arrangements that reference historical sources without replicating literal archival examples.

The main materials are selected for surface quality and durability, with wallpapers printed on textured papers and fabrics woven for upholstery or soft furnishings. The collection’s production methods combine digital printing precision with surface treatments that enhance tactile presence. Colourways vary from muted neutrals to deeper tones, and pattern scales are offered in multiple repeat sizes to suit both large and compact interior applications.
